Technical Trend Evolution and Price Momentum

AGI Infra Ltd’s current price stands at ₹313.30, marking a 3.33% increase from the previous close of ₹303.20. The stock touched a high of ₹313.30 today, nearing its 52-week high of ₹316.80, while maintaining a low of ₹296.80. This price action reflects robust buying interest and a positive momentum shift in the short term.

The technical trend has upgraded from mildly bullish to bullish, signalling stronger momentum. This is supported by the daily moving averages which are firmly bullish, indicating that the stock’s short-term price is trading above its key moving averages, a classic sign of upward momentum.

MACD and RSI: Divergent Signals Across Timeframes

The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) indicator presents a bullish outlook on both weekly and monthly charts, reinforcing the positive momentum. The weekly MACD line remains above its signal line, suggesting sustained buying pressure, while the monthly MACD confirms a longer-term bullish trend.

Conversely, the Relative Strength Index (RSI) offers a more nuanced picture. While the weekly RSI currently shows no definitive signal, the monthly RSI remains bearish. This divergence suggests that although short-term momentum is building, the stock may still be consolidating on a longer timeframe, cautioning investors to monitor for potential overbought conditions in the coming weeks.

Bollinger Bands and KST Indicator Insights

Bollinger Bands on both weekly and monthly charts are bullish, indicating that price volatility is expanding upwards and the stock is trending near the upper band. This typically signals strong buying interest and potential continuation of the upward trend.

However, the Know Sure Thing (KST) indicator presents mixed signals: mildly bearish on the weekly chart but bullish on the monthly. This suggests some short-term profit-taking or consolidation may occur, but the longer-term momentum remains intact.

Volume and Dow Theory Analysis

On-Balance Volume (OBV) does not currently indicate a clear trend on either weekly or monthly timeframes, implying that volume has not decisively confirmed the price moves yet. Similarly, Dow Theory analysis shows no definitive trend on weekly or monthly charts, highlighting the importance of watching for confirmation in coming sessions.

Comparative Returns Highlight Strong Outperformance

AGI Infra Ltd’s price momentum is further validated by its impressive returns relative to the Sensex. Over the past week, the stock gained 1.80% while the Sensex declined by 3.84%. Over one month, AGI Infra surged 22.62% compared to a 5.61% drop in the benchmark. Year-to-date returns stand at 19.28% versus a negative 7.16% for the Sensex, and over the past year, the stock has soared 91.62%, vastly outperforming the Sensex’s 8.39% gain.

Longer-term performance is even more striking, with a three-year return of 548.12% against the Sensex’s 32.28%, and a five-year return of 5,494.64% compared to 55.60% for the benchmark. Over a decade, AGI Infra has delivered a staggering 2,953.61% return, dwarfing the Sensex’s 221.00% gain. These figures underscore the stock’s strong fundamental and technical positioning within the Realty sector.
